How they compare
Côte d'Ivoire currently reports 499.85 millions against 497.62 millions in Ethiopia, a difference of 2.23 millions.
Across all 6 years both countries report, Ethiopia has been ahead every year.
Côte d'Ivoire ranks 33rd and Ethiopia ranks 34th of 65 countries.
Ethiopia has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Côte d'Ivoire | Ethiopia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 117.07 millions | 367.53 millions | 250.46 millions | Ethiopia |
| 2010s | 151.99 millions | 596.31 millions | 444.32 millions | Ethiopia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
